What we have done in out first year in government to promote Community Ownership

On this day one year ago, we won the general election which returned Labour to power after 14 years in opposition. We campaigned on a promise to end the chaos & decline which the Tories inflicted and deliver the change local people have been crying out for: economic stability, rebuilt public services, and rising living standards.

At that election, promoting Community Ownership was one of my four priorities for the people of Oldham West, Chadderton & Royton, and this is what we have done so far to safeguard heritage buildings and community venues for local people:

โœ… ๐’๐š๐ฏ๐ž๐ ๐Ž๐ฅ๐๐ก๐š๐ฆ ๐‚๐จ๐ฅ๐ข๐ฌ๐ž๐ฎ๐ฆ at its historic home on Fairbottom Street, with its 500 seats retained ready for 2026 to bring back its Christmas pantomime and a space to give local young people opportunities to learn and enter creative industries.

โœ… Put ๐–๐ž๐ฌ๐ญ ๐„๐ง๐ ๐’๐ญ๐ซ๐ž๐ž๐ญ ๐ฉ๐ข๐ญ๐œ๐ก๐ž๐ฌ ๐จ๐ง ๐š ๐ฉ๐š๐ญ๐ก ๐ญ๐จ ๐ซ๐ž๐ง๐ž๐ฐ๐š๐ฅ with facilities the surrounding community deserves, setup in a co-operative ownership model, so the facility is in the hands of local people. After visiting to reaffirm our support in early 2024, campaigning on the issue during the general election, taking Council officials there after the election; we then organising a clean-up event last October with local organisations, volunteers, community groups & the Council.

โœ… Passed the Great British Energy Act into law, which has set up the publicly owned company that includes a remit to ๐ค๐ข๐œ๐ค๐ฌ๐ญ๐š๐ซ๐ญ ๐š ๐œ๐จ๐ฆ๐ฆ๐ฎ๐ง๐ข๐ญ๐ฒ-๐จ๐ฐ๐ง๐ž๐ ๐ž๐ง๐ž๐ซ๐ ๐ฒ ๐ซ๐ž๐ฏ๐จ๐ฅ๐ฎ๐ญ๐ข๐จ๐ง. A ยฃ1 billion a year investment to create 1 million owners of UK produced renewable energy.

โœ… ๐‘๐ž-๐จ๐ฉ๐ž๐ง๐ž๐ ๐‘๐จ๐ฒ๐ญ๐จ๐ง ๐“๐จ๐ฐ๐ง ๐‡๐š๐ฅ๐ฅ and Library fully restored for community use and back to its former glory, thanks to a Labour-led Council investing to protect the rich heritage of a great town.

โœ… Launched ๐’๐ฉ๐จ๐ซ๐ญ๐ฌ๐“๐จ๐ฐ๐ง ๐š๐ญ ๐๐จ๐ฎ๐ง๐๐š๐ซ๐ฒ ๐๐š๐ซ๐ค, a ยฃ70 million multi-sports centre of excellence from grassroots sport for all, up to elite performance Further & Higher Education sports academies. This builds on the stability and certainty created when we secured the ground as an Asset of Community Value, leading to a ground-sharing deal with Roughyeds and now stable club owners who have promotion for Latics back into the Football league.

โœ… Started to build ๐‚๐จ๐ฆ๐ฆ๐ฎ๐ง๐ข๐ญ๐ฒ ๐๐ซ๐ข๐ญ๐š๐ข๐ง, the Co-operative Party’s leading campaign to transform our country. It is about asking the political system to look at community as a powerful tool for solving serious social and economic problems – not just as an afterthought.

โœ… Worked with ๐€๐•๐‘๐Ž ๐…๐‚ and the Council on empowering grassroots football in our borough and delivering great facilities to local people in the surrounding area in a way which is done of, by and for local people.

โœ… For the first time, a government has ๐›๐š๐œ๐ค๐ž๐ ๐œ๐จ๐ฆ๐ฆ๐ฎ๐ง๐ข๐ญ๐ฒ-๐ฅ๐ž๐ ๐ก๐จ๐ฎ๐ฌ๐ข๐ง๐  ๐ฐ๐ข๐ญ๐ก ๐Ÿ๐ฎ๐ง๐๐ข๐ง๐ , including ยฃ20 million to support co-operatives and community land trusts, putting local people in control of where and how homes are built.

โœ… Set out our plans to ๐ž๐ฑ๐ฉ๐š๐ง๐ ๐ญ๐ก๐ž ๐‚๐จ๐ฆ๐ฆ๐ฎ๐ง๐ข๐ญ๐ฒ ๐Ž๐ฐ๐ง๐ž๐ซ๐ฌ๐ก๐ข๐ฉ ๐…๐ฎ๐ง๐ and introduce a strengthened ‘Right to Buy’ Assets of Community Value in the English Devolution White Paper, creating a more robust pathway to community asset ownership allowing communities to purchase cherished assets that are at risk of being lost.

Our goal is a decade of national renewal and, while we are encouraged by this progress so far, we are not complacent and know there is much more still left to do.
